Ticket: Formula sandbox drift on Calcroft prod. Hey on-call — the sandbox limits for user-supplied formulas got loosened on node group B at some point (probably during the Penhallow hotfix) and nobody reverted. Exec timeout and memory caps don't match what's in the repo, which is why the abuse alerts look weird. Current live values on group B follow.

deployment values, hahip-kajep:
HOLAX_PIN=4003
HOLAX_METRICS_HOST=metrics.holax.zemvarworks.internal
HOLAX_LOG_LEVEL=warn
HOLAX_TENANT=fraael

Welcome to on-call for the Glimmerpane design system! Our snapshot tests live in the `snapcheck` suite and run on every merge to main. If a UI component changes visually, the diff bot flags it — usually it's an intentional tweak, so just approve the new baseline. If it's 2am and snapshots are failing across the board, it's almost always a font-loading race, not your problem. To unlock the baseline store and re-approve snapshots in bulk, use the recovery passphrase below.

recovery phrase for tahag-taguf: wenix-caswyn

Q: Why are users of Pellwick getting logged out mid-session? A: A race in the session-token refresh path lets an expired token overwrite a fresh one when two tabs refresh simultaneously. Fixed in build 7.3.2; earlier builds need the mitigation flag single_refresh_lock enabled. Do not ship a release without confirming the flag state, since the regression reappears if config is copied from stale templates. The flag audit procedure is documented on this page.

operations page: https://confluence.qorvellabs.internal/pages/projects/projects/projects